This monograph, part of the esteemed Chapman & Hall/CRC Monographs on Statistics and Applied Probability series, delves into the law of likelihood, a critical concept often overlooked in traditional statistical methodologies. Statistical Evidence: A Likelihood Paradigm challenges the conventional wisdom by offering a fresh perspective that bridges the gap between frequentist and Bayesian statistics.
